Prometheus.
Or as Ilike to call it, Ambivalence the movie! I've never been so torn after seeing a movie, I loved it as much as I hated it!
I loved how well it fleshed out the alien universe, loved seeing the Jockey's in action (even if they shrunk a few feet in height since alien), loved David and that scene of David faffing about the ship while everyone was in cryo? Marvellous! However...
I hated the entire human side of the story. Inconsistent characterisation with the biologist was infuriating! Biologist finds corpse of alien species, probably the creator of humanity "Oh noes I is scared! Me no want to see life changing discovery! RUN AWAY!" then later... "Oh some pissed of alien snake/worm? ME WANTS TO HUG YOU!" Urgh. WTF... And it's just not that, it's the tone of the film, this was meant to be a return to horror/thriller? Shame it lacked to specific antagonist so the movie flounders around and has zero tension.
The Squid baby was a good idea that was dealt with too quickly, that should have been a larger focus of the film, don't rush through it, slow down the gestation process, give a glimpse of it, BUILD SOME TENSION! But no, "You are preggers with monster! we want!" "No!" *Runs for emergency caesarian* Seems like a missed opportunity.
And finally, I would have prefered not seeing the deacon, the film had already done a perfect job explaining the Alien origin, it didn't need to be beaten over our heads. But I guess it was for the casual idiot who needed to see some sort of alien to be satisfied. Also, the design of the deacon looked like a bad fan design. But I'll concede that it's impossible to have a design that didn't look like a half-assed knock-off.
In short.
Awesome universe building. Anything to do with the Jockeys and design was spectacular. Magneto was an awesome robot!
Bland and uninteresting human element/story, inconsistent and annoying characters, Terrible old man makeup, and unsubtle Alien origin.
Oh and the best part? It completely voids the AvP films! For that alone Ridley deserves an award.
